Sean, how many scholarships do we give?

  • I happen to stumble upon this site. Seems we have 72 scholarships out going into 2011. That leaves only 13 for this class. How do we get to 15-16? Seems we are telling Gill no more spaces?

    Also, really looks like CB/Safeties are in need.

    Thanks!

  • wjgrable said...

    Diddy, thanks for the update and I always value your insight.

    Can you shed some more light on some of the players you listed below:

    1) Wedderburn: Is this more academic then work ethic?

    2) One of the QB's is two. Which one do you think?

    3) I think Yancich is three. Has this been confirmed? With Bani & CC gone, I would think he would see some quality pt this year.

    4) Curtis Dukes: I am sure it is tough being # 4 on the depth chart, but he still has 3 years of eligibility, right?

    5) Shawney Kersey: Is he enrolled for the spring semester?

    6) Christian Kuntz: If his body holds up, do you think the staff keeps him at wr or moves him to the secondary?

    7) Andrew Szczerba: Are you hearing 1/2 full or 1/2 empty after the surgery?

    8) Sean Stanley: This would be a shame because he had a promising freshman year, but fell off so much this past year.

    9) What have you heard about potential grey shirts?

    Thanks.

    1. Academics. I think that's been reported everywhere. He's had a tough time adding weight physically as well.

    2. No idea, but both are back. I think the Bolden thing will blow over. Newsome...not sure he'll stick with football, but he might stay at PSU. Seems to be enjoying college more than being a football player. Good kid with other interests (music mainly). If he were interested in switching positions, there are several of us who would love to see him audition at safety or perhaps RB.

    3. Not confirmed, just my speculation based on those I speak with. He's buried in the DC and several younger guys saw time over him this past year. Not sure where he fits in for the future when adding Hull and Royer to the mix.

    4. As Sean said, he's in school. We'll find out more after spring practice, but he wants PT...now.

    5. Ditto on Kersey.

    6. We'll have to see if Kuntz is physically able to keep going...he's piling up the injuries. If he is, I think it would make a lot of sense to move him to the secondary, but that will have to do with a few factors. I'm sure McQueary would like him to grow into Brackett's role in the offense, but I think he makes a better safety personally.

    7. Everybody says the surgery went well, including Andy. But that doesn't necessarily make me any more optimistic about his contributions. His disc issue is extremely delicate, so there's no way to properly predict what he will be capable of. If he is healthy, he will be a beast...but if spring practices don't go well, I don't think the likelihood of him playing again would be very high.

    8. Stanley needs to keep his nose clean...ditto with Thomas. Both are very promising players, but Stanley was a bit of a disappointment both on and off the field this year. If they can lay off the puff, they both still have the raw talent to be very good players.

    9. Sean would know, but that topic doesn't sound like it's come up at all with any of the recruits this year. If anybody, a kid like Gill would be someone in that category, but it looks like everybody will be coming in on time.
